paulkerThe mother of a Nigeria Senator, Emmanuel Paulker who was kidnapped by gunmen last week has been set free through the effort of a combined team of Armed Policemen and ex-militant leaders in Bayelsa State.
The aged mother of the Senator was dumped at a fishing camp in Azuzuama community of Southern Ijaw Local Government Councils of the State. NewsGenesis gathered that pressure from security operatives resulted into the successful release of the women. She was dumped 30 kilometres from where she was abducted.
A close family source told newsmen that the Senator told him that his mother was set free due to the intervention of the former Militant Leader and National Coordinator of the South-South Region Peace Advocacy Group, the Leadership, Peace and Cultural Development Initiative (LPCDI), General Pastor Reuben.
Thisday reports that following an intelligence report, a police Inspector said to have links with the criminals was arrested along with a suspect identified as Abass, a known Auto Mechanic along the Edepie area of the State capital.
